Symptoms Indicating a Noisy Bicycle

Recognizing symptoms that point to a noisy bicycle is vital for early diagnosis and repair. The following points detail specific indicators that a cyclist may encounter:

  • Chain noise: Squeaking or grinding sounds during pedaling may suggest a need for lubrication or chain replacement.
  • Braking noise: Squealing or grinding sounds when applying brakes can indicate worn brake pads or misalignment.
  • Wheel noise: Any clicking or popping sounds from the wheels could suggest loose spokes or bearings needing adjustment.
  • Gear noise: Clunking or skipping when shifting gears typically reflects issues with the derailleur or worn cogs.
  • Frame noise: Unusual creaking sounds from the frame may indicate loose bolts or issues with the bottom bracket.

Performing a basic noise check on a bicycle is a straightforward process that can help pinpoint issues. Begin by inspecting the chain for excessive wear and ensuring it is properly lubricated. Listen for noise as you pedal slowly while applying the brakes to assess their functionality. Additionally, check the wheels for any obvious signs of wear or misalignment by spinning them and observing for any wobble or noise.

Lubrication Routine for Bicycle Parts

To ensure all necessary parts are adequately lubricated, follow the steps below:

1. Gather Materials

Collect all necessary tools and materials, including a bicycle-specific lubricant, cleaning rags, and brushes.

2. Clean the Components

Before applying lubricant, clean the parts thoroughly. Use a rag to wipe down areas where dirt and grime have accumulated, particularly on the chain and derailleur.

3. Lubricate the Chain

Apply a few drops of lubricant to each link of the chain while slowly pedaling backward. This ensures even distribution.

4. Lubricate the Derailleur

Apply lubricant to the pivot points of the derailleur, as these areas can create noise if not properly maintained.

5. Lubricate Cables

If your bike has cable-actuated brakes or derailleurs, add lubricant to the cables where they exit their housings. This can help reduce friction and noise during operation.

6. Wipe Off Excess

After lubricating, wipe off any excess lubricant to prevent dirt buildup.

7. Check Other Moving Parts

Ensure to lubricate any additional moving parts such as the brake calipers and pedal bearings as needed.In addition to lubrication, ensuring that all components are properly tightened is vital in minimizing noise. Inspection of the Chain

The bicycle chain is a vital component that transfers power from the pedals to the wheels. A noisy chain can indicate it is either dirty, dry, or worn out. Regular inspection and maintenance of the chain are necessary to prevent noise and improve performance. To ensure optimal functionality, consider the following checklist for chain inspection and maintenance:

  • Check for visible dirt or rust on the chain links.
  • Inspect for stiff links that may not move freely.
  • Ensure the chain is properly lubricated; apply appropriate bike chain oil if needed.
  • Measure the chain for wear using a chain checker tool; replace if it is stretched beyond the recommended limit.
  • Verify the chain alignment with the cassette and chainrings to avoid miscommunication of noise.

Inspection of the Brakes

Brakes are essential for safety and performance but can be a significant source of noise if not properly maintained. Squeaking or grinding sounds often indicate issues such as misalignment or worn pads.A thorough brake inspection should include:

  • Check brake pads for wear; replace them if they are worn down to the indicators.
  • Inspect the alignment of brake pads with the wheel rim; ensure they are correctly positioned.
  • Look for debris or grime on the brake pads and rims, which can cause noise.
  • Test the brake cables for fraying or wear, replacing them if necessary.
  • Examine the brake levers for smooth operation and proper return action.

Inspection of Wheel Bearings

Wheel bearings facilitate the smooth rotation of the wheels and are crucial for a quiet ride. Noise in this area can stem from insufficient lubrication or damaged bearings.To maintain the wheel bearings effectively, perform the following checks:

  • Spin the wheel and listen for any grinding or clicking sounds.
  • Check for play in the wheel by rocking it side to side; excessive movement may indicate bearing issues.
  • Inspect the hub for any signs of rust or corrosion that could affect performance.
  • Ensure that the bearings are properly lubricated; if not, consider repacking with high-quality bearing grease.
  • Confirm that the axle is properly tightened and that all components are securely fastened.

Isolating Components to Identify Noise Sources

The process of isolating parts involves systematically testing each component of the bicycle to pinpoint where the noise is generated. This methodical approach can save time and ensure accurate diagnosis. The following steps Artikel an effective isolation technique:

See also  How To Fix A Bent Derailleur Hanger

1. Visual Inspection

Start with a thorough visual examination of all components, looking for signs of wear, misalignment, or damage.

2. Static Testing

While the bicycle is stationary, gently shake or move individual parts, such as the handlebars, seat, and wheels. Listen for any sounds that may indicate loose components.

3. Dynamic Testing

Take the bicycle for a short ride while focusing on listening for specific noises. Pay attention to variations in sound with different riding conditions (e.g., turning, braking, and accelerating).

4. Component Isolation

If a noise is suspected from a particular area, remove or disconnect components one at a time. For example, if you suspect the pedals, remove them and check for noise when rotating the crank arms.

5. Record Keeping

Document the findings at each step, noting which components are silent and which produce noise. This log will help in understanding patterns and isolating the issue.By following these steps, cyclists can effectively narrow down the source of persistent noise, leading to a clearer path for resolution.

Comparative Noise Reduction Techniques for Bicycle Types

Different types of bicycles may require tailored noise reduction techniques to adequately address their unique designs and components. The following considerations highlight various approaches suitable for specific bicycle types:

Road Bikes

These bikes often experience noise from the drivetrain. Regular lubrication of the chain and derailleurs, along with periodic inspection of the bottom bracket, can significantly reduce noise.

Mountain Bikes

Given their exposure to rugged terrain, mountain bikes may face noise from loose components or chain slap. Adding chainstay protectors and ensuring proper tighten of bolts can mitigate such sounds.

Hybrid Bikes

These bicycles often combine features of road and mountain bikes. Attention should be paid to wheel alignment and brake adjustments, as improper setup can lead to squeaking or grinding noises.

BMX Bikes

The high-impact nature of BMX riding can cause noise from the headset and hubs. Regularly checking and tightening these components, along with using quality bearings, can help lessen noise levels.By applying these tailored noise reduction techniques, cyclists can achieve optimal performance and an enjoyable riding experience across various bicycle types.

Benefits of Lubricants and Cleaning Products

Using the right lubricants and cleaning products can greatly reduce noise and improve the overall performance of your bicycle. It is essential to select products designed specifically for bicycles to ensure compatibility with various components.

Quality lubricants can minimize friction, protect against corrosion, and enhance the lifespan of bicycle parts.

Commonly used lubricants include:

Dry Lubricants

Ideal for dusty environments, they prevent dirt buildup.

Wet Lubricants

Best for wet conditions, providing a protective barrier against water and rust.Cleaning products are equally important. A bicycle-specific degreaser will effectively remove grime from the chain and drivetrain, while frame cleaners can safely clean the bike’s exterior without damaging the paint.
